WebYou can convert a US gallon to a liter by multiplying the number of the US gallons by the conversion ratio of 3.785411784. For example, here’s how to convert 7 US gallons to liters: (7 × 3.785411784) = 26.497882488 liters. Web22 mei 2024 · The Imperial Gallon. The imperial gallon is equal to 4.54609 liters or 277.42 cubic inches. This unit of measurement was equal to 10 pounds or 4.54 kg of water at a temperature of 17 °C. The imperial gallon is divided into four quarts. Each of these quarts consists of two pints, while each of these pints equals 20 fluid imperial ounces. WebGallon to Liter Conversion. Web29 jan. 2024 · 3.7854 liters or 231 cubic inches equals one US gallon. A US liquid gallon of water weighs 3.78 kgs or 8.34 pounds at 62F (17C). When compared to the imperial gallon, it is 16.6% lighter. A US gallon is divided into four quarts, each quart into two pints, and each pint holds 16 US fluid ounces, prec... Web1 Liter (L) is equal to 0.26417205236 gallon (gal). To convert liters to gallons, multiply the liter value by 0.26417205236 or divide by 3.785411784. For example, to convert 5 liters to gallons, divide 5 by 3.785411784, that makes 1.32 gallons in 5 liters. liters to gallons formula. gallon = liter * 0.26417205236.
